Durval Lelys, band leader, is the face of Asa de Águia. His irreverence made him a figure quite charismatic, knowing how to rock the public like no one else. Durval is an architect, graduated from UFBA, but he left the drawing board to devote himself to the art career. He is singer, guitarist and composes most of the hits of the group.
Leví Pereira is a very experienced bassist and vocalist, a musician of great personality, and is also a composer. He began his career at age 16, bringing all the knowledge of years of work with Armandinho and the whole family of unforgettable Osmar Macedo.
Leading the heartbeat rhythm of drums of Asa de Águia is Rady Santos. A known musician in Bahia and with a beat full of energy, he commands with strong hands the band marking. He began his career playing in dancing balls at the age 16 in Barrocas (BA), his home town. Besides drums, Rady is also a songwriter and sings in performances of Asa.
A Uruguayan player of keyboard, Ricardo Ferraro came to Brazil in January 1987 to visit the beaches of Bahia. He fell in love with the place and decided to stay in the land, where he met Durval Lelys who invited him to join the group. Currently, the musician is on solo career as DJ Rambo.
Ubajara Carvalho is the drummer of the band. He also came from the school of Dodô and Osmar, and he was invited by Durval and Levi to join Asa de Águia. Bajara is also a composer and has some successful partnerships with Luiz Caldas, Durval Lelys, Carlinhos Brown and David Sersan.
In the Carnival of Salvador, Asa leads the blocks CocoBambu and Me Abraça. In micaretas through the country, the band leads the block Cerveja & Coco, a partnership between Asa de Águia and Ivete Sangalo, since 2005.
In addition to the blocks, differentiated projects of shows such as Trivela, Mica Hall, Carna Hall, FeijoAsa, Cocobambu Folia, Asa Beach, ArraiAsa, Asa Country, Asa Beats and ASA 3D were also developed, adding more innovation to its performances. The lyrics of "Sabor Legal" by Asa de Águia portray a lively and vibrant scene, where the singer has anchored his boat in the waters of paradise. There are women of all types - blondes, whites, and brunettes - and everything seems to be perfect. The sky is bluer, and people are dancing reggae in Mucugê. The secret seems to be in the village, where even waiting in line to drink Capeta (a popular Brazilian cocktail) is worth it. The chorus repeats the phrase "que sabor legal" (what a great taste) and introduces the "capetinha do arraial" (the little devil of the countryside), a reference to the potent Capeta cocktail that is the center of the party.
Throughout the song, there are references to specific places and events, such as the "barraca do parracho" and the "beco das cores do ipitinga." These are real locations in Brazil, known for their lively nightlife and celebratory atmosphere. The rap section adds to the energetic nature of the song, combining different musical styles and infusing it with Asa de Águia's unique sound.
Overall, "Sabor Legal" is a catchy and celebratory song that highlights the joys of living in the moment and enjoying life to the fullest.
